BONUS: Father Guilty of Supplying Son with AR-15
"Mind Over Murder" co-hosts Bill Thomas and Kristin Dilley discuss the case of Georgia father Colin Gray, who was found guilty of supplying his troubled son Colt with an AR-15 style assault rifle which the son used in a 2024 school shooting which killed four and injured nine people. His now 16 year son Colt will be tried separately. This bonus episode of "Mind Over Murder" originally ran on March 25, 2026.
